速卖通素材
努力

腾讯云轻量应用服务器怎么才能看到GUI界面?

服务器

腾讯云轻量应用服务器(Lighthouse)默认安装的是 Linux 系统,而 Linux 系统本身是没有图形界面(GUI)的。要看到 GUI 界面,你需要按照以下步骤手动安装并配置桌面环境。

以下是实现这一目标的完整流程:

第一步:连接服务器

首先通过 SSH 工具(如 PuTTY、Xshell、Windows 自带的 ssh 命令或腾讯云控制台自带的 VNC)登录到服务器。

ssh root@你的服务器IP
# 输入密码后进入命令行

第二步:更新软件源并安装桌面环境

轻量应用服务器通常使用 Ubuntu、Debian、CentOS 或 AlmaLinux。请根据你的系统版本选择对应的命令。

场景 A:Ubuntu / Debian 系统

推荐使用轻量级的 XFCE4 桌面,因为它占用资源少,适合云服务器。

# 1. 更新软件包列表
sudo apt update && sudo apt upgrade -y

# 2. 安装 XFCE4 桌面环境和必要的显示管理器 (lightdm)
sudo apt install xfce4 lightdm -y

# 3. 设置 LightDM 为默认显示管理器
sudo dpkg-reconfigure lightdm
# 在弹出的界面中,使用方向键选择 lightdm 并回车确认

场景 B:CentOS / AlmaLinux / Rocky Linux

这些系统默认使用 GNOME,但为了节省资源,同样推荐安装 XFCE4。

# 1. 启用 EPEL 源 (如果尚未启用)
sudo yum install epel-release -y

# 2. 安装桌面环境组 (包含 XFCE4)
sudo yum groupinstall "Xfce" -y

# 3. 安装显示管理器 (xorg-x11-server-Xorg 和 xterm 等依赖)
sudo yum install xorg-x11-server-Xorg xterm -y

# 4. 设置默认运行级别为图形模式
sudo systemctl set-default graphical.target

第三步:开放防火墙端口

图形界面通常通过 VNC 协议传输,默认端口是 5900。你需要在腾讯云控制台和服务器内部同时放行该端口。

1. 腾讯云控制台设置

  1. 登录 腾讯云控制台。
  2. 进入 轻量应用服务器 页面,点击你的实例。
  3. 点击右侧的 安全组 -> 修改规则
  4. 添加一条 入站规则
    • 类型:自定义
    • 端口范围:5900
    • 授权对象:0.0.0.0/0 (允许所有 IP,生产环境建议限制为特定 IP)
    • 动作:允许

2. 服务器内部防火墙设置

  • 如果是 Ubuntu/Debian
    sudo ufw allow 5900/tcp
    sudo ufw reload
  • 如果是 CentOS/RHEL
    sudo firewall-cmd --permanent --add-port=5900/tcp
    sudo firewall-cmd --reload

第四步:启动图形界面服务

重启服务器以确保图形服务正常加载:

sudo reboot

等待几分钟让服务器完全启动。

第五步:如何连接查看 GUI

由于 Linux 的 GUI 无法像 Windows 那样直接“远程桌面”连接,你需要通过 VNC ViewerWeb VNC 来访问。

方法一:使用腾讯云控制台内置的 Web VNC(最简单)

这是最推荐的方式,无需额外安装软件。

  1. 登录腾讯云控制台。
  2. 进入轻量应用服务器详情页。
  3. 点击顶部的 “更多” 或直接找到 “远程连接” 按钮。
  4. 选择 "Web VNC"
  5. 此时你应该能看到图形化登录界面(通常是 XFCE 的登录屏)。
  6. 输入你的用户名和密码即可进入桌面。

方法二:使用本地 VNC Viewer 客户端

如果你更喜欢本地客户端操作:

  1. 下载并安装 TightVNCRealVNC Viewer
  2. 打开软件,输入地址:你的服务器IP:5900
  3. 连接时可能需要设置一个 VNC 密码(如果没有自动弹出,可以尝试在终端运行 vncpasswd 设置,或者直接使用 Web VNC 中的登录密码作为 VNC 密码,具体取决于安装时的配置)。
    注:对于刚安装的 XFCE+LightDM,通常不需要单独设置 VNC 密码,直接使用系统登录密码即可,或者使用 Web VNC 方式最为稳妥。

常见问题与优化建议

  1. 性能问题
    轻量服务器的 CPU 和内存通常较小(如 2 核 2G)。运行完整的 Windows 风格桌面会非常卡顿。

    • 建议:保持使用 XFCE4 桌面,不要安装 GNOME 或 KDE Plasma,它们对资源消耗较大。
    • 技巧:关闭不必要的动画效果,安装 xfce4-power-manager 优化电源管理。
  2. 网络延迟
    图形界面的响应速度受网络带宽影响极大。如果感觉鼠标移动有严重延迟,尝试降低屏幕分辨率(在桌面设置中调整)。

  3. 替代方案
    如果你只是需要图形化管理工具(如宝塔面板),而不是整个桌面操作系统,可以直接在命令行安装 宝塔面板 (Baota)Webmin,这样可以通过浏览器访问图形化后台,比折腾 VNC 更稳定且流畅。

    • 宝塔安装示例(Ubuntu):curl -sS http://download.bt.cn/install/install_ubuntu.sh | bash

通过以上步骤,你就可以在腾讯云上成功看到并使用 Linux 的图形界面了。

未经允许不得转载:轻量云Cloud » 腾讯云轻量应用服务器怎么才能看到GUI界面?